logo

Output ad59b33a53f05d8a6ebd29fea057c7e054e7e96913bab2dfbe04b41990559f90:0

value
700000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be3875433345fcc5c5a850696c8905cf2a33036d OP_EQUAL
address
3K2owmPM5PhVfNHnYynAydEjsszCjH1Y2g
transaction
ad59b33a53f05d8a6ebd29fea057c7e054e7e96913bab2dfbe04b41990559f90